Abstract

Apparatus for separating a pair of contiguous rollers from each other, the rollers being located beneath a cover. The apparatus includes: a pair of opposed, side frames; a lower roller fixedly mounted to the side frames; an upper roller adjustably mounted to the side frames; a biasing agent to bias the upper roller against the lower roller; a cover for the upper and lower roller pivotably mounted to the side frames; and a cable connected to the cover and to the upper roller. When the cover is pivoted from its closed positon to its open position, the cable is caused to move the upper roller away from the lower roller.
